Pros and Cons

Acer Swift 1

Strengths

The Acer Swift 1 is the best budget laptop available in the market.
It has a premium-looking design with an aluminum metal body, slim profile, and matte finish.
The device has plenty of ports for connectivity features, including HDMI port, two USB 3.0 ports, USB type-C 3.1 port, audio jack, and SD card reader.
The battery life is impressive, providing nearly 7 hours of battery life on medium brightness, 10 hours for full HD video playback, and 6 hours for daily usage and office work.
The keyboard is nice and comfortable for long sessions of typing, with big keys well-placed except the top row which may take some time to get used to.
The touchpad is big, beautiful, with matte finish, integrated keys, and supports Windows 10 gestures.

Weaknesses

The device has a mixed bag performance due to its entry-level hardware, making it unsuitable for pro users or those who perform heavy tasks.
The fingerprint sensor can be finicky at times, so it's best not to rely on it too much.
The downward-firing speakers are a drawback, producing muffled audio when positioned low, making earphones necessary for entertainment and media purposes.
The screen brightness is quite low, and color saturation is not great, but viewing angles are good thanks to the IPS screen.
Storage capacity of 64GB is limited, leaving little room for user files or installed software.
No backlighting is provided in the keyboard, which may be a drawback for some users.

Acer Swift 1

The Acer Swift 1 is an impressive entry-level laptop that punches above its weight in terms of design and performance. With a slim aluminum body, premium looks, and ample ports, this notebook makes a great first impression. The 14-inch full HD display offers sharp images, although brightness could be improved. Battery life is impressive, lasting up to 10 hours on video playback. While not ideal for heavy users or gamers, the Swift 1 shines as a budget-friendly option for casual activities and everyday tasks.

Acer Chromebook Spin 13

The Acer Chromebook Spin 13 is a powerhouse device that checks all the right boxes. With its unique 3:2 aspect ratio screen, sleek design, and robust specs, it's an attractive option for those seeking a capable Chromebook. The inclusion of a Core i5 processor, 8GB RAM, and 128GB storage makes it a solid choice for productivity on-the-go. But is the price tag of $800 too steep?
